Method and system for activity classification
An activity classifier system and method that classifies human activities using 2D skeleton data. The system includes a skeleton preprocessor that transforms the 2D skeleton data into transformed skeleton data, the transformed skeleton data comprising scaled, relative joint positions and relative joint velocities. The system also includes a gesture classifier comprising a first recurrent neural network that receives the transformed skeleton data, and is trained to identify the most probable of a plurality of gestures. The system also has an action classifier comprising a second recurrent neural network that receives information from the first recurrent neural networks and is trained to identify the most probable of a plurality of actions.

COMBINATION BAG
A combination bag, includes a sling bag and a backpack with an interior space, wherein the sling bag includes: a flat-shaped and foldable bag body with a first surface and a second surface, a rigid support structure embedded within the flat-shaped bag body, symmetrically arranged along a fold line of the flat-shaped bag body; a shoulder strap attached to the flat-shaped bag body; at least two bag components positioned on the second surface of the flat-shaped bag body, for forming an independent storage compartment; and the interior space is defined by a first wall, a second wall opposite the first wall, and a continuous side wall connecting the first and second walls; wherein the first wall has an area approximately equal to that of the flat-shaped bag body, and flat-shaped bag body is detachably fixed and close contacted with the first wall by a connecting component.

Fashion carry bag assembly with detachable purse
A carry bag assembly that includes a first shoulder bag and a smaller second hand bag. The two bags can be carried separately as a unit. The first shoulder bag has a front surface, a rear surface, a first side surface, and a second side surface. Two bands extend from the shoulder bag that extend beyond the front surface of the shoulder bag. The second hand bag contains a first belt loop and a second belt loop. The belt loops receive the bands that extend from the shoulder bag. Mechanical connectors connecting the first band to the second band around the hand bag. This selectively locks the smaller hand bag into a fixed position against the front surface of the larger shoulder bag. The two bags can share graphics of design themes so that the two bags appear to be a single unit when attached.
